While making some flamethrowers, I made a mistake and experimented on the Elemental damage line. Much to my surprise, it increased the DPS. Not by as much as speed, but enough so I'm wondering how useful it is. One of these days, I'll pull the commando out to test it. But for now, I'm making heavy weapons and experimenting with combos just to see what gets picked up. I know SAC is a killer nad speed slices are fairly common. I'm beginning to really like tyhe post CU weapon crafting world. There seem to be a lot of possibilities out there.

Yes, I suspect we'll see a use for high-damage elemental weapons in the future when people come across enemies with real high kinetic/energy resists or armor.
I did some tests on Heavy Acid Rifles, and putting 10 points into regular damage and 2 into speed, I got 138 DPS.
I then tried putting 10 point into Elemental damage and 2 points into regular damage, and got something like 132 DPS. Not better as such, but significant increase in the elemental part of the damage. Might be very handy for certain types of opponents.
